Application process
The FCC encourages consumers who wish to file a complaint to do so on their website, consumercomplaints.fcc.gov, but consumers may also call, mail or fax.

The Federal Communications Commission regulates communications by radio, television, wire, satellite and cable, to protect the rights of the consumer. Consumers may file complaints in the following areas: disability access to communications, junk faxes, telemarketing, wired phone, wireless phone, broad band, broadcast TV, cable, etc. The FCC Call Center also processes Freedom of Information Act requests.

Providing organization
FEDERAL COMMUNICATIONS COMMISSION
The FCC was established by the Communications Act of 1934 and is charged with regulating interstate and international communications by radio, television, wire, satellite and cable.
